SOY SURVEY SAYS

There's a favorable atmosphere in the marketplace for soy products. That's according to an exclusive online survey in which almost 75% of respondents said they have purchased soy-based food, beauty or home products. Additionally, 74% of respondents to the same survey say they believe soy-based food products are a healthier alternative to traditional food items. The Corn And Soybean Digest conducted the survey in November 2005 among soybean growers.

The items most commonly purchased by those surveyed included soy-based candles (51%), soyfood (49%), soy-based lotion (26%) and soy-based cleaning product (24%).

Two-thirds of those surveyed say they promote the use of soy products in their community.And, nearly half (47%) of the respondents to this online survey said they specifically look for soy ingredients in food, beauty, cleaning and other products. However, the same amount of respondents (47%) to this survey said they are not willing to pay more for a product simply because it has a soy ingredient.

About half (51%) of those responding to The Corn And Soybean Digest online survey feel that soy-based products are readily available in their area, while 93% of those surveyed report that biodiesel is available within 30 miles of their home.

One-fourth of the respondents to this online survey have access to or ownership in a soybean processing facility.

To learn more about soy products, visit an online guide provided by the United Soybean Board at www.unitedsoybean.org/public_soyproducts.cfm. Products are arranged in three categories: Consumer Products, Ingredients and Intermediates and Industrial Products.

ATTITUDES ABOUT SOY-FOODS HAVE IMPROVED

The soybean checkoff sponsored 2005 Consumer Attitudes About Nutrition survey indicates that consumers have changed their views of soyfoods for the better.

The survey shows:

  • 88% of respondents consider soybean oil as one of the two healthiest oils, second only to olive oil.

  • 78% of respondents perceive soyfood products as healthy. Since last year's survey, more consumers have enjoyed soy veggie burgers regularly and nearly 40% of respondents have tried plain white tofu.

  • 27% of respondents stated that they consumed soyfoods or soy beverages at least once a week.
